On Chloris Standing By The Fire

Faire Chloris, standing by the Fire, An amorous coale with hot desire Leapt on her breast, but could not melt The chaste snow there--which when it felt For shame it blusht; and then it died There where resistance did abide, And lest she should take it unkind Repentant ashes left behind.
